Overview of the Outdoor Job Market in Oman
The outdoor job sector in Oman is experiencing steady growth, driven by major infrastructure projects, expansion in the logistics sector, and increased focus on tourism and facilities. Oman's strategic geographic location and diverse terrain—from coasts to mountains and deserts—create a continuous demand for a workforce capable of operating in these varied environments.
Fields of Available Outdoor Jobs
Based on current advertisements on job portals, expected opportunities span the following fields:
- Construction and Building Sector: This is one of the largest sectors employing outdoor labor. Jobs include specialized technicians, site supervisors, site civil engineers, qualified construction workers, and quality and safety inspectors.
- Logistics and Transportation Sector: Given Oman's role as a logistics hub, opportunities exist for heavy truck drivers, equipment operators at ports (like Sohar Port), and outdoor warehouse and handling staff.
- Utilities and Services Sector: This includes jobs for outdoor maintenance technicians for electricity, telecommunications, and water networks, public area and garden cleaners for residential complexes and government facilities, and service staff in the tourism sector (e.g., desert or mountain resorts).
- Agriculture and Fisheries Sector: Opportunities exist, though more specialized, in modern farms and aquaculture projects spread across the Sultanate's governorates.
General Required Qualifications and Skills
Requirements vary according to the specific nature of the job, but there are common traits employers seek:
- Physical Fitness and Stamina: To cope with outdoor working conditions, which may involve hot weather or physical exertion.
- Discipline and Reliability: Commitment to work schedules and a responsible attitude in performing assigned tasks.
- Safety Skills: Awareness and application of occupational health and safety procedures in outdoor environments is a top priority.
- Ability to Work in a Team: Most outdoor jobs rely on collective teamwork to achieve goals.
- Practical Skills: Hands-on experience or a technical qualification (like a diploma) is often more valued than academic qualifications alone in these fields.
- Mobility Flexibility: Willingness to work at different sites within a governorate or potentially across the Sultanate, depending on project requirements.

How to Apply for These Jobs
Since the announcement is general and indicates multiple opportunities, the application process involves the following steps:
- Visit Job Portals: Go to leading electronic job portals in the Gulf region like "Naukrigulf" or local Omani recruitment platforms.
- Use Search Keywords: Use keywords such as "Outdoor Jobs Oman," "وظائف خارجية عُمان," "Construction Jobs Oman," "Site Jobs" while setting the location to the Sultanate of Oman.
- Filter Results: Browse the listed jobs, paying attention to the posting date to ensure the opportunity is still active.
- Prepare Your CV: Update your resume to highlight relevant practical experience and technical skills for the targeted outdoor job, mentioning any safety certificates or vocational training.
- Apply Online: Follow the application instructions for each individual advertisement, which is typically via an online form or by sending your CV to the email address provided.
We advise due diligence and caution to verify the credibility of the recruiting entity before submitting any sensitive personal information or official documents.
